  • Attack Surface Management (ASM) is a proactive security discipline focused on continuously discovering, analyzing, and reducing an organization’s external-facing digital footprint.

    In 2025, with the proliferation of cloud services, remote work, and supply chain dependencies, an organization’s attack surface has grown exponentially.

    Top ASM solutions have evolved beyond simple asset inventory to provide AI-driven risk scoring, automated discovery of “shadow IT,” and continuous monitoring from a hacker’s perspective, helping security teams find and fix vulnerabilities before attackers can exploit them.

    Why We Choose It

    Traditional vulnerability management often struggles to provide a complete picture of an organization’s exposed assets.

    ASM solves this by taking an “outside-in” view, identifying unknown, misconfigured, or unmanaged assets that could serve as entry points for an attacker.

    The best solutions for 2025 leverage a combination of internet-wide scanning, passive reconnaissance, and active probing to provide a single, unified view of all internet-facing assets, including those in the cloud, acquired through mergers, or managed by third parties.

  • A critical zero-day vulnerability in Citrix NetScaler products, identified as CVE-2025-6543, has been actively exploited by threat actors since at least May 2025, months before a patch was made available.

    While Citrix initially downplayed the flaw as a “memory overflow vulnerability leading to unintended control flow and Denial of Service,” it has since been revealed to allow for unauthenticated remote code execution (RCE), leading to widespread compromise of government and legal services worldwide.

    In late June 2025, Citrix released a patch for CVE-2025-6543. However, by that time, attackers had already been leveraging the vulnerability for weeks.

    The exploit was used to infiltrate NetScaler remote access systems, deploy webshells to ensure persistent access even after patching, and steal credentials.

    Evidence suggests that Citrix was aware of the severity and the ongoing exploitation but failed to disclose the full extent of the threat to its customers, Kevin Beaumont said.

    The company provided a script to check for compromise only upon request and under restrictive conditions, without fully explaining the situation or the script’s limitations.

    The Dutch National Cyber Security Centre (NCSC) has played a pivotal role in exposing the true nature of the attacks. Their investigation confirmed that the vulnerability was exploited as a zero-day and that attackers actively covered their tracks, making forensic analysis challenging.

    The NCSC’s report, released in August 2025, stated that “several critical organizations within the Netherlands have been successfully attacked” and that the vulnerability was abused since at least early May.

    How the Exploit Works

    The same sophisticated threat actor is also believed to be behind the exploitation of another zero-day, CVE-2025–5777, also known as CitrixBleed 2, which was used to steal user sessions.

    Investigations are ongoing to determine if this actor is also responsible for exploiting a more recent vulnerability, CVE-2025-7775.

    The CVE-2025–6543 vulnerability allows an attacker to overwrite system memory by supplying a malicious client certificate to the /cgi/api/login endpoint on a vulnerable NetScaler device.

    By sending hundreds of these requests, an attacker can overwrite enough memory to execute arbitrary code on the system. This method gives them a foothold in the network, which they have used to move laterally into Active Directory environments by misusing stolen LDAP service account credentials.

    Security professionals urge all organizations using internet-facing Citrix NetScaler devices to take immediate action.

    System administrators should check for signs of compromise, which include looking for large POST requests to /cgi/api/login in web access logs, often in quick succession.

    A corresponding NetScaler log error code of 1245184, indicating an invalid client certificate, is a strong indicator of an exploitation attempt.

    The NCSC has released scripts on GitHub to help organizations check for compromise on live hosts and in coredump files.

    If a system is believed to be compromised, the recommended steps are:

    • Immediately take the NetScaler device offline.
    • Image the system for forensic analysis.
    • Change the LDAP service account credentials to prevent lateral movement.
    • Deploy a new, patched NetScaler instance with fresh credentials.

    The U.S. Cybersecurity and Infrastructure Security Agency (CISA) has added CVE-2025-6543 to its Known Exploited Vulnerabilities (KEV) catalog, underscoring the urgency for organizations to apply patches and hunt for signs of malicious activity.

  • A new malware campaign, dubbed “Sindoor Dropper,” is targeting Linux systems using sophisticated spear-phishing techniques and a multi-stage infection chain.

    The campaign leverages lures themed around the recent India-Pakistan conflict, known as Operation Sindoor, to entice victims into executing malicious files.

    This activity’s standout feature is its reliance on weaponized .desktop files, a method previously associated with the advanced persistent threat (APT) group APT36, also known as Transparent Tribe or Mythic Leopard.

    The attack begins when a user opens a malicious .desktop file, named “Note_Warfare_Ops_Sindoor.pdf.desktop,” which masquerades as a standard PDF document.

    According to Nextron system analysis, upon execution, it opens a benign decoy PDF to maintain the illusion of legitimacy while silently initiating a complex, heavily obfuscated infection process in the background.

    'Sindoor Dropper' Malware Targets Linux Systems
    ‘Sindoor Dropper’ Malware Targets Linux Systems

    This process is designed to evade both static and dynamic analysis, with the initial payload reportedly having zero detections on VirusTotal at the time of its discovery.

    ‘Sindoor Dropper’ Malware Targets Linux Systems

    The .desktop file downloads several components, including an AES decryptor (mayuw) and an encrypted downloader (shjdfhd).

    The decryptor, a Go binary packed with UPX, is intentionally corrupted by stripping its ELF magic bytes, likely to bypass security scans on platforms like Google Docs. The .desktop file restores these bytes on the victim’s machine to make the binary executable again.

    This kicks off a multi-stage process where each component decrypts and runs the next. The chain includes basic anti-virtual machine checks, such as verifying board and vendor names, blacklisting specific MAC address prefixes, and checking machine uptime.

    All strings within the droppers are obfuscated using a combination of Base64 encoding and DES-CBC encryption to further hinder analysis.

    The final payload is a repurposed version of MeshAgent, a legitimate open-source remote administration tool. Once deployed, MeshAgent connects to a command-and-control (C2) server hosted on an Amazon Web Services (AWS) EC2 instance at wss://boss-servers.gov.in.indianbosssystems.ddns[.]net:443/agent.ashx.

    This gives the attacker full remote access to the compromised system, enabling them to monitor user activity, move laterally across the network, and exfiltrate sensitive data, Nextron said.

    The Sindoor Dropper campaign highlights an evolution in threat actor tradecraft, demonstrating a clear focus on Linux environments, which phishing campaigns have less targeted.
